How do I set up a system to continuously append new email responses to an existing Google Sheet

using Coefficient google-sheets Add-in (500k+ users)

Learn how to automatically append new email responses to Google Sheets using scheduled imports and smart filtering without overwriting existing data.

Desktop Hero Image

“Supermetrics is a Bitter Experience! We can pull data from nearly any tool, schedule updates, manipulate data in Sheets, and push data back into our systems.”

5 star rating coeff g2 badge

Setting up a system to continuously append new email responses to your existing Google Sheet requires automated imports that add new data without overwriting historical information. You need scheduled updates that capture fresh emails and place them below existing entries.

This guide shows you how to create a self-updating email repository that grows automatically while preserving all your historical data.

Continuously append email responses using Coefficient

Coefficient’s Append New Data feature combined with scheduled Gmail imports creates a powerful system for continuously adding new email responses below existing data. The system tracks timestamps and prevents duplicates while maintaining your complete email history.

How to make it work

Step 1. Create initial Gmail import configuration.

Connect your Gmail account through Coefficient and set up filters to target specific email responses using sender criteria, subject line patterns, date ranges, or keywords. Select the fields you want to extract like sender, date, subject, and body summary.

Step 2. Enable append mode in import settings.

In your import configuration, select “Append new data” and choose your target sheet and starting row. Coefficient will automatically add a “Written by Coefficient At” timestamp column and never overwrite existing rows, only adding new data below.

Step 3. Schedule continuous updates with deduplication.

Set refresh frequency to hourly, daily, or weekly based on your email volume. Enable “Only append new records” and set a unique identifier like email ID or thread ID to prevent the same email from being added multiple times.

Step 4. Configure dynamic filters for ongoing capture.

Use dynamic date filters like “Last 7 days” or “Since last import” to ensure you only capture new emails during each refresh. This prevents processing the same emails repeatedly while ensuring no new responses are missed.

Build a living email database

Automated email appending creates a continuously growing database of responses that updates without manual intervention while preserving all historical data. Start building your automated email repository and never miss important responses again.

700,000+ happy users
Get Started Now
Connect any system to Google Sheets in just seconds.
Get Started

Trusted By Over 50,000 Companies